BMW Dewan Motors Cautions Pakistanis on Imported Cars

Dewan Motors, the official BMW importer in Pakistan, has issued a warning about unauthorized imports of BMW electric vehicles from the UK and Japan. The company has noted that certain traders are bringing these vehicles into Pakistan without proper authorization, which raises concerns about their compliance with local regulations.

The notification highlights that BMW vehicles imported through unofficial channels may not meet Pakistani standards for fuel quality and other conditions, potentially posing safety and security risks. Dewan Motors emphasizes that only vehicles purchased through their authorized dealer network will meet local specifications and be covered under warranty.

To ensure customers receive the full benefits and support, Dewan Motors urges buyers to purchase BMW vehicles exclusively from their authorized dealers. Unauthorized imports will not be eligible for warranty coverage and may not meet necessary safety standards.
